Places to Visit in Sanandaj:

Sanandaj Bazaar: Explore the vibrant Sanandaj Bazaar, where you can shop for Kurdish handicrafts, rugs, textiles, and traditional goods. The bazaar is also a great place to immerse yourself in local culture.

Sanandaj Museum: Visit the Sanandaj Museum to learn about the history and culture of Kurdistan Province through a collection of artifacts, traditional costumes, and exhibits.

Taq Bostan Park: Relax in Taq Bostan Park, a scenic park with beautiful gardens and ponds. It’s an excellent place for a leisurely stroll or a picnic.

Dinaran Village: Take a short trip to the nearby Dinaran Village, known for its unique architecture and beautiful landscapes. The stepped houses and terraced fields are a sight to behold.

Darolfonoon: Explore Darolfonoon, an old government building with architectural significance. While the interior isn’t accessible to the public, the building itself is a historical landmark.

Best Time To Visit Sanandaj:

The best time to visit Sanandaj is during the spring (April to June) and early autumn (September to October) when the weather is mild and pleasant.

Travel Tips for Sanandaj:

Language: Kurdish is widely spoken in Sanandaj, but you can also communicate in Persian (Farsi) in urban areas. Learning a few Kurdish phrases can enhance your experience.

Currency: The Iranian Rial (IRR) is the local currency. Cash is widely used, so it’s advisable to carry enough with you.

Respect Local Customs: Be mindful of Kurdish customs and traditions, especially when visiting local homes or engaging with residents.

Weather: Check the weather forecast, as Kurdistan experiences cold winters and warm summers.

Safety: Sanandaj is generally safe for travelers, but exercise standard precautions and be aware of local guidelines.
